Our verdict is Pathogenic. Variant got 18 ACMG points: 18P and 0B. PVS1PM2PP5_Very_Strong

The NM_000051.4(ATM):c.1396C>T(p.Gln466Ter) variant causes a stop gained change.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.00000248 in 1,613,914 control chromosomes in the GnomAD database, with no homozygous occurrence. In-silico tool predicts a pathogenic outcome for this variant.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Pathogenic (★★). Synonymous variant affecting the same amino acid position (i.e. Q466Q) has been classified as Uncertain significance. Variant results in nonsense mediated mRNA decay.

ATM (HGNC:795): (ATM serine/threonine kinase) The protein encoded by this gene belongs to the PI3/PI4-kinase family. This protein is an important cell cycle checkpoint kinase that phosphorylates; thus, it functions as a regulator of a wide variety of downstream proteins, including tumor suppressor proteins p53 and BRCA1, checkpoint kinase CHK2, checkpoint proteins RAD17 and RAD9, and DNA repair protein NBS1. This protein and the closely related kinase ATR are thought to be master controllers of cell cycle checkpoint signaling pathways that are required for cell response to DNA damage and for genome stability. Mutations in this gene are associated with ataxia telangiectasia, an autosomal recessive disorder. [provided by RefSeq, Aug 2010]

Pathogenic, criteria provided, single submitterclinical testingWomen's Health and Genetics/Laboratory Corporation of America, LabCorpSep 14, 2020Variant summary: ATM c.1396C>T (p.Gln466X) results in a premature termination codon, predicted to cause a truncation of the encoded protein or absence of the protein due to nonsense mediated decay, which are commonly known mechanisms for disease. Truncations downstream of this position have been classified as pathogenic by our laboratory (e.g. c.3372C>G p.Tyr1124X , c.3663G>A p.Trp1221X). The variant was absent in 251410 control chromosomes (gnomAD). c.1396C>T has been reported in the literature in individuals affected with Ataxia-Telangiectasia (Buzin_2003, Jackson_2016) and in an individual with breast cancer (Mei-Lu_2019). These data indicate that the variant may be associated with disease. To our knowledge, no experimental evidence demonstrating an impact on protein function has been reported. Three ClinVar submitters (evaluation after 2014) cite the variant as as pathogenic. Based on the evidence outlined above, the variant was classified as pathogenic. -

Pathogenic, criteria provided, single submitterclinical testingColor Diagnostics, LLC DBA Color HealthJan 23, 2023This variant changes 1 nucleotide in exon 10 of the ATM gene, creating a premature translation stop signal. This variant is expected to result in an absent or non-functional protein product. This variant has been observed in the compound heterozygous state in individuals affected with autosomal recessive ataxia-telangiectasia (PMID: 12552559, 26896183), indicating that this variant contributes to disease. This variant has also been reported in individuals affected with breast cancer (PMID: 30128536, 35365198). This variant has not been identified in the general population by the Genome Aggregation Database (gnomAD). Loss of ATM function is a known mechanism of disease (clinicalgenome.org). Based on the available evidence, this variant is classified as Pathogenic. -
Pathogenic, criteria provided, single submitterclinical testingAmbry GeneticsDec 28, 2021The p.Q466* pathogenic mutation (also known as c.1396C>T), located in coding exon 9 of the ATM gene, results from a C to T substitution at nucleotide position 1396. This changes the amino acid from a glutamine to a stop codon within coding exon 9. This truncating mutation was seen in conjunction with pathogenic variants in ATM in individuals diagnosed with ataxia-telangiectasia (Buzin CH et al, Hum. Mutat. 2003 Feb; 21(2):123-31, Jackson TJ et al. Dev Med Child Neurol, 2016 07;58:690-7). This alteration is expected to result in loss of function by premature protein truncation or nonsense-mediated mRNA decay. As such, this alteration is interpreted as a disease-causing mutation. -

Pathogenic, criteria provided, single submitterclinical testingGeneDxJun 28, 2017This pathogenic variant is denoted ATM c.1396C>T at the cDNA level and p.Gln466Ter (Q466X) at the protein level. The substitution creates a nonsense variant, which changes a Glutamine to a premature stop codon (CAA>TAA), and is predicted to cause loss of normal protein function through either protein truncation or nonsense-mediated mRNA decay. This variant has been reported in the compound heterozygous state in an individual with ataxia-telangiectasia (Buzin 2003) and is considered pathogenic. -
